Good to know
  • Strășeni is widely recognized in Moldova for its long-standing tradition of viticulture and the production of sparkling wines.
  • The city is located in a transition zone between the Codru forest plateau and the Dniester river valley, influencing its hilly topography.
  • Many of the surrounding villages in the district maintain distinct architectural styles for their parish churches, reflecting local Orthodox traditions.

About Strășeni

Strășeni serves as the administrative center of the Strășeni District in central Moldova, positioned approximately 25 kilometers northwest of the capital, Chișinău. The region is characterized by its rolling vineyard landscapes and a strong emphasis on religious heritage, highlighted by sites like the Biserica Ortodoxă Sf. Ierarh Nicolae. Local community life centers around public spaces like Mihai Eminescu Park and administrative landmarks such as the Consiliul Raional Strășeni. Visitors often explore the surrounding villages to discover historic religious sites, including the notable Sireti Monastery and the Biserica Cojușna.

Plan your visit to Strășeni

Best time to visit

May to September, when the mild climate is most suitable for exploring the rural landscape and outdoor areas like the local parks.

How many days

1-2 days, as the core of the city and its immediate surrounding attractions in Cojușna and Sireți can be covered in a brief visit.

Getting around

The city is best navigated by car or local minibus (marshrutka) connections from Chișinău, as public transit within the district is primarily road-based.

Where to stay

Visitors generally prefer staying in local guesthouses within the district or commuting from the nearby capital of Chișinău.

Budget

Strășeni is a budget-friendly destination, with lower costs for local services and food compared to major European capitals.
